Imagine witnessing the very moment life begins within the human body — in real time. For years, scientists have yearned to understand the precise mechanisms of embryo implantation, the crucial first step toward pregnancy. Now, in a groundbreaking feat, researchers have managed to capture this elusive process on camera — and it could change everything we know about fertility and miscarriage.
